Warning: file_get_contents(/data/phpspider/zhask/data//catemap/7/elixir/2.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
是否可以在hybris中使用灵活的搜索返回HJPTS、ACLT、propTS字段?_Hybris - Fatal编程技术网

是否可以在hybris中使用灵活的搜索返回HJPTS、ACLT、propTS字段?

是否可以在hybris中使用灵活的搜索返回HJPTS、ACLT、propTS字段?,hybris,Hybris,我是hybris的初学者,我注意到使用select*from{itemType}的查询返回以下名为hjmpts、aCLTS和propTS的字段。但是当我使用select{hjmpts}、{aCLTS}、{propTS}from{itemType}时,hybris返回这些字段不存在 有人知道是否可以创建一个灵活的搜索来返回hjmpts、aCLTS和propTS字段吗?这个在HAC中有效: SELECT hjmpts, aclts, propTS FROM {Employee} 这些属性不是类型属

我是hybris的初学者,我注意到使用
select*from{itemType}
的查询返回以下名为
hjmpts
aCLTS
propTS
的字段。但是当我使用
select{hjmpts}、{aCLTS}、{propTS}from{itemType}
时,hybris返回这些字段不存在

有人知道是否可以创建一个灵活的搜索来返回
hjmpts
aCLTS
propTS
字段吗?

这个在HAC中有效:

SELECT hjmpts, aclts, propTS FROM {Employee}
这些属性不是类型属性。如果在Backoffice中查看类型的属性,则不会看到它们。这可能就是为什么不需要包括花括号

还可以将其与类型属性混合使用:

SELECT hjmpts, aclts, propTS, {uid} FROM {Employee}
这个在HAC工作:

SELECT hjmpts, aclts, propTS FROM {Employee}
这些属性不是类型属性。如果在Backoffice中查看类型的属性,则不会看到它们。这可能就是为什么不需要包括花括号

还可以将其与类型属性混合使用:

SELECT hjmpts, aclts, propTS, {uid} FROM {Employee}

也许如果你省略字段的花括号?但你为什么要这么做?谢谢你。它就像一个符咒。我正在使用Flexible Search研究查询,我不明白为什么使用这些列,为什么它们没有显示在查询返回中,而是使用*来显示。它们可能是Hybris内部控制列,这些列都是底层Hybris持久层的一部分。“ts”位表示时间戳,它们是类型持久化到数据库的不同区域的不同计数器/版本字段。它们的管理层远低于在Hybris中开发时所看到的任何层,如果省略字段的花括号,可能会怎么样?但你为什么要这么做?谢谢你。它就像一个符咒。我正在使用Flexible Search研究查询,我不明白为什么使用这些列,为什么它们没有显示在查询返回中,而是使用*来显示。它们可能是Hybris内部控制列,这些列都是底层Hybris持久层的一部分。“ts”位表示时间戳,它们是类型持久化到数据库的不同区域的不同计数器/版本字段。它们的管理层远远低于在Hybris中开发时看到的任何东西